
Staring at the mirror again
I scoff at the self absorption
As he returns to the car mirror.
Constant rechecking.
Eyes flickering
Road, mirror, but then
I realise you are staring
At the van following behind.
That was the day I understood
Your true love for mirrors.
A tool forewarning you of a threat,
Allowing you to drive your family to safety.
Minal Naomi is an artist and designer based in Colombo, Sri Lanka. This piece is a reflective one about her childhood. It describes a retrospective moment of realisation, about the complexities of being raised by a family of journalists in Sri Lanka during the years of the civil war.
